AFP Gaza office hit by Israeli strike, 3 Palestinian reporters killed in other 
attacks

Two Israeli strikes have left three Palestinian journalists dead, with media 
buildings targeted by the IDF two days in a row. The AFP building was hit in 
another attack later on, with no casualties reported.

Mahmoud al-Koumi and Husam Salameh, cameramen for the local al-Aqsa TV station, 
were killed in a car marked with a press sign near the al-Wihda towers in Gaza.

Both journalists were 30 years old and fathers of four children. Two other 
al-Aqsa employees were wounded in the first strike.

The second attack killed the director of al-Quds Educational Radio, Muhammad 
Abu Aisha, in his car.

In the latest strike, the AFP building in Gaza was hit, with no casualties 
reported so far.
